Description

5,5'-[(4-Methyl-1,3-Phenylene)Bis(Azo)]Bis[Toluene-2,4-Diamine] is a specialized bis-azo aromatic amine compound, serving as a critical intermediate in the synthesis of high-performance dyes and pigments. Its precise molecular structure enables the development of colorants with excellent thermal stability and vivid hues, which are essential for demanding industrial applications. This chemical is primarily sought by manufacturers in the dye and pigment, polymer, and specialty chemical industries for producing advanced materials.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at ambient temperature (15-25°C). Keep away from heat, sparks, and open flame. Due to its light-sensitive nature, containers should be kept in the original packaging or opaque containers until use.
